Eco Friendly Cleaning: Simple Tips for a Greener Home

Want a clean house that doesn’t trash the planet? You can get there with a few easy swaps and smart product picks. Below you’ll find hands‑on advice that works for everyday messes, plus guidance on spotting genuinely green cleaners.

Everyday Green Cleaning Hacks

Start with the basics you already have. White vinegar is a powerhouse for laundry, kitchen counters, and glass. Add a cup to the rinse cycle to soften fabrics and banish odors without harsh chemicals. Just remember: vinegar’s acidity can damage marble, stone, or waxed wood, so skip it on those surfaces.

Baking soda works as a gentle abrasive and deodorizer. Sprinkle it on a damp sponge to scrub sinks, tubs, or greasy pans. Mix it with a little water for a paste that lifts stains without scratching.

If you need a disinfectant, combine 1 part hydrogen peroxide with 1 part water in a spray bottle. It kills germs on doors, toys, and bathroom fixtures, and it breaks down into water and oxygen, leaving no toxic residue.

For a fresh scent, a few drops of lemon or tea‑tree essential oil added to any of the above solutions boost cleaning power and leave a natural fragrance.

Choosing Truly Eco‑Friendly Products

Not every “green” label means the product is safe for the environment. Check the ingredient list: look for plant‑based surfactants, biodegradable formulas, and avoid phosphates, chlorine bleach, and synthetic fragrances.

When you see a brand like Clorox or Lysol, dig into their eco‑certifications. Some lines are formulated with greener chemistry, but the regular versions still contain harsh chemicals. Opt for their “green” sub‑brand or switch to certified alternatives.

All‑purpose cleaners made from coconut‑derived ingredients or corn‑based solvents can match commercial strength without the toxin load. Brands that use recycled packaging also cut waste, giving you a double win.

Remember the “green chemistry” rule: the fewer ingredients, the easier it is to assess safety. A simple mix of water, a splash of vinegar, and a few drops of essential oil often beats a multi‑ingredient spray bottle.

Finally, reduce waste by refilling containers. Many local stores let you bring your own bottles to fill with bulk cleaners, saving plastic and money.
